释义 | pneumaturian. Medicine. The passage of air or gas in the urine. ΘΚΠ the world > health and disease > ill health > a disease > disorders of internal organs > urinary disorders > [noun] > other bladder disorders cystorrhœa1851 urolithiasis1865 pneumaturia1883 neurogenic bladder1930 1883 Lancet 3 Mar. 375/2 Dr. Guiard proposes the term ‘diabetic pneumaturia’, to denominate a condition which he has observed in four cases of urinary infection in the male, complicated with glycosuria. 1898 Jrnl. Amer. Med. Assoc. 31 375/1 The cases of pneumaturia may be roughly divided into three groups. 1952 Radiology 59 63/1 Primary pneumaturia is rare and is due to fermentation of urine in the bladder through the agency of some fermenting organism. 1985 Amer. Jrnl. Med. 78 619/1 Although bladder instrumentation is likely to be the most common cause of pneumaturia in the United States at present, the condition is short-lived and resolves spontaneously. 2004 Amer. Jrnl. Surg. 188 619/1 We also observed that many of our physician colleagues have the misconception that pneumaturia may be caused by a UTI [= urinary tract infection].
